
Children's Week will be celebrated from Saturday 23 October to Sunday 31 October 2010.
Our celebrations will coincide with Universal Children's Day on Wednesday 27 October 2010.
Children’s Week is a national event recognising the talents, skills, achievements and rights of young people. It is based on the articles expressed in the United Nations Convention on the Right of the Child, highlighting play, wellbeing and protection.
The Department works in partnership with local governments, Victorian schools and early childhood services to host activities during Children's Week that focus community attention on the needs and achievements of children and young people as they thrive, learn and grow. The activities are based around this year's theme of A Caring World Shares.
